Tropical Desert
A desert located in a tropical climate, characterized by high temperatures, minimal rainfall, and sparse vegetation.
Temperate Desert
A biome characterized by low precipitation, moderate temperatures compared to other deserts, and specific vegetation adapted to these conditions.
Rain Shadow
A dry area on the leeward side of a mountainous area, where less rain falls due to the obstruction of precipitation by the mountains.
Ecological Communities
Groups of interacting species that live in the same area and are interconnected through various ecological processes.
